//Round Trip - https://cses.fi/problemset/task/1669
#include <bits/stdc++.h>
using namespace std;
typedef long long ll;
const int MOD = 1e9 + 7;
const ll INF = 1e18;
void solve() {
int n, m;
cin >> n >> m;
vector<vector<int>> g(n);
for (int i = 0; i < m; i++) {
int u, v;
cin >> u >> v;
u--, v--;
g[u].push_back(v);
g[v].push_back(u);
}
int start = -1;
vector<bool> seen(n, false);
vector<int> next(n, -1);
auto dfs = [&](auto dfs, int current, int prev) -> bool {
seen[current] = true;
for (auto &nei: g[current]) {
if (nei == prev) continue;
if (seen[nei]) {
next[current] = nei;
start = nei;
return true;
}
next[current] = nei;
if (dfs(dfs, nei, current)) {
return true;
}
}
return false;
};
for (int i = 0; i < n; i++) {
if (!seen[i] && dfs(dfs, i, -1)) {
vector<int> cycle;
int current = start;
do {
cycle.push_back(current);
current = next[current];
}
while (current != start);
cycle.push_back(start);
cout << cycle.size() << endl;
for (auto &node: cycle) {
cout << node + 1 << " ";
}
cout << endl;
return;
}
}
cout << "IMPOSSIBLE" << endl;
}
int main() {
ios_base::sync_with_stdio(false);
cin.tie(nullptr);
int T = 1;
// cin >> T;
while (T--) {
solve();
}
return 0;
}
